Blockchain-Based Supply Chain Traceability and Transparency in Cloud Environments
Abstract
Ensuring traceability and transparency in supply chains is critical for improving operational efficiency and reducing fraud. This paper presents a blockchain-based supply chain management framework integrated with cloud platforms to enable real-time data sharing and verification. Smart contracts automate transaction validation and enforce compliance with supply chain protocols. The framework ensures data immutability, enhances trust among stakeholders, and provides end-to-end visibility into product movement and provenance. Performance analysis shows that the system reduces reconciliation times and improves data accuracy. The study concludes that blockchain-based traceability enhances supply chain integrity and operational efficiency.
